How will the revised chemotherapy benefits under MediShield Life and MediSave impact my claims from 1 September 2022?

Each cancer drug treatment on the Cancer Drug List (CDL) will have its own MediShield Life claim limits and MediSave withdrawal limits.

You may refer to the MOH website for the list of cancer drug treatments that are claimable under MediShield Life and MediSave, and their respective claim and withdrawal limits. Please also consult your doctor if you wish to find out whether the treatment that you are currently undergoing is on the list.

The CDL will only come into effect for Integrated Shield Plans (IPs) on 1 April 2023. If you have an IP, you will continue to be covered under your current policy terms until it is renewed on or after 1 April 2023.

For example, if your IP is up for renewal on 1 November 2023, the CDL and its revised limits will only apply then. Insurers may decide to cover treatments beyond the CDL under their riders, though the extent of coverage may vary. Your insurer should inform you of the details of your IP and rider coverage by end 2022.
